Back to photostream

KVS 613

KVS 613 - Auxillary Fire Service - Land Rover I, 86 utility. Odiham Fire Show on 3rd August 2008 - (c) Peter Jarman

521 views
5 faves
0 comments
Uploaded on April 2, 2011
Taken on April 2, 2011